Another cool night is expected as temperatures are set to drop into the 40s and 50s across northeast Minnesota and northwest Wisconsin.
Starting Thursday, temperatures are expected to rise, reaching the mid-70s to around 80 degrees. This warm spell is predicted to persist through the weekend, accompanied by rising humidity levels as dew points approach, and may even exceed, the 60-degree mark from Friday into Saturday.
The Northland will experience dry conditions until Friday morning. However, there is a possibility of a few showers in northern Minnesota by Friday afternoon and evening. On Saturday, the likelihood of isolated to scattered showers and some thunderstorms increases as a cold front moves southward from Ontario.
Note: It appears that Duluth and Superior will remain dry through Saturday morning, with the forecast indicating a possibility of showers and a few thunderstorms Saturday afternoon.

The region is experiencing a pleasant mid-July afternoon with temperatures ranging from the mid-60s to the low 70s in northeast Minnesota and northwest Wisconsin.

This afternoon, temperatures were approximately 5 to 10 degrees below the usual range.

Today, numerous clouds are drifting south-southeast over the Northland, influenced by an upper-level trough and the movement of cooler air.

This month, the average temperatures in northeast Minnesota and northwest Wisconsin have been slightly above normal, with an increase of approximately +1 to +2 degrees.

Average temperatures and deviations from the norm for July 2024 (up to the 16th)
Brainerd, MN: 70.8 degrees, +1.2 degrees above normal
Duluth, MN: 68.4 degrees, +2.0 degrees above normal
Ashland, WI: 67.6 degrees, +1.4 degrees above normal
International Falls, MN: 66.7 degrees, +2.1 degrees above normal
Hibbing, MN: 64.6 degrees, +1.3 degrees above normal
The highest temperatures recorded this month.
Ashland: 90 on the 14th
Duluth: 87 on the 14th
Brainerd: 87 on the 14th
International Falls: 86 on the 12th and 11th
Hibbing: 84 on the 12th and 11th
